Procedures Offered
FUT
FUT (Follicular Unit Transplantation), also known as the "strip method," involves surgically removing a narrow strip of scalp from the donor area, typically the back of the head. The strip is then carefully dissected under a microscope to separate individual hair follicles, which are implanted into the recipient areas. While this technique leaves a linear scar that requires longer hair to conceal, it allows surgeons to harvest a large number of high-quality grafts in a single session, making it cost-effective for patients needing extensive coverage.
FUE
FUE (Follicular Unit Extraction) is a minimally invasive hair transplant technique where individual hair follicles are extracted one by one from the donor area using a small circular punch tool. The harvested follicles are then carefully implanted into the balding or thinning areas of the scalp. This method leaves tiny, nearly invisible scars rather than a linear scar, resulting in faster healing and the ability to wear shorter hairstyles. Because of this, FUE is the most popular hair transplant technique today.
Dr. Amir Yazdan is a highly regarded hair restoration surgeon and the founder of Modena Hair Institute. He earned his medical degree from Ross University School of Medicine after completing his undergraduate studies in Biology at the University of California. Dr. Yazdan underwent his residency training at Kaiser Permanente, gaining comprehensive experience in both cosmetic and emergency medicine. He is a board-certified physician and an active member of the International Society of Hair Restoration Surgery (ISHRS), as well as the International Alliance of Hair Restoration Surgeons (IAHRS). Dr. Yazdan has been recognized as one of the Top 25 Hair Transplant Doctors in the World by Ape to Gentleman and Spencer Stevenson. He specializes in FUE and FUT procedures and is known for his expertise in performing hair transplants for diverse ethnic hair types, as well as repairing previous procedures.
